"K-Ville" is a cop drama on FOX in post-Hurricane Katrina New Orleans, where the cops and citizens alike deal with trauma and the task of rebuilding that city.

The rub for many is, will the work be worth it? Or, just cut and run and make a life elsewhere.
Anthony Anderson plays good cop Marlin Boulet, a New Orleans cop who stuck it out, and wants to bring it back. "(We want) to bring back a sense of hope to the community," actor Anthony Anderson told reporters during a stop at the TCA TV critics press tour in Beverly Hills. "We want to bring back jobs and revenue, and help in that rebuilding process."
Boulet's stomping ground is the devastated Ninth Ward, he's a local guy who loves the food and the frisson of the Big Easy.
